Business is picking up as people are realizing that with the current economic conditions, it makes more sense to invest in remodeling “the heart of the home” – the kitchen, rather than entertaining outside of the home.

Architects, designers, and contractors benefit from the fact, that here in the United States when it comes outfitting a kitchen with appliances, there are hundreds of resources available to ensure you are current with the latest products, specifications and trends that help facilitate finding the right solutions that meet your clients needs. In the Caribbean and Latin America however, where product availabilty is vast but the installation, warranty, and code regulations more complicated, resources to assist you are limited.

LCi Distributors, a full service distributor of high-end kitchen appliances to the Caribbean and Latin America, was founded to service consumers off-shore so that they also could receive the same type of experience in terms of customer service and warranty, as consumers in the Unites States. While this may sound easy and simple enough, providing warranty in 27 countries takes focus, determination and dedication; that of which LCi has become known for in the appliance industry.

LCi decided to start a blog, because through our experience in helping customers (whether in Nassau, Port of Spain, Guatemala City or Buenos Aires), solve some of their after sales issues, we found that many of them could have been avoided, if better information and resources had been available to them and their specificers prior to purchasing. Weather the issue be simple (like will a Gaggenau Oven that is 220v work on the island of Nevis that is 208v) or more complex (how do I adapt a built in Viking refrigerator to an environment where there is no air conditioning), there is no one resource or forum for information that specifically covers all those countries; hence the creation of the LCi blog.
